Kiwis congratulated for historic win
The Acting Prime Minister, Bill English, is congratulating the Kiwis on winning last night's 2008 Rugby League World Cup.
"The Kiwis demonstrated total commitment and showed that a strong desire to win can beat a seemingly unbeatable opponent."
The Kiwis beat the Kangaroos 34-20 in Brisbane last night - something no New Zealand league team has done in 12 previous World Cup competitions in the past 54 years.
"Thousands of New Zealanders shared the Kiwis' delight at the unexpected taking of the World Cup from Australia.
"They are deserving world champions."
